In 18th Century, Human Alarm Clocks Employed In Britain Were Known As?



Long before the advent of reliable and inexpensive mechanical alarm clocks and even longer before the days of customizable smartphone alarm ring tones, there was a long-since-vanished profession: the knocker-upper. The profession emerged in the early years of the Industrial Revolution in Britain. via Pocket http://ift.tt/1inz1sL
